Technical Field
The utility model relates to a carton processing equipment technical field, concretely relates to carton edge cutting processingequipment convenient to shear.
Background
Carton processing needs carry out the cutting edge processing with the cardboard that production was accomplished, is convenient for buckle the cardboard and bonds, accomplishes the finished product processing, and the cardboard is when carrying out the cutting edge processing, and conventional cutting edge machine can take place the cardboard occasionally and tailor the phenomenon of in-process slip displacement when carrying out the cardboard and tailorring, and then leads to tailorring the seam skew, destroys the cardboard structure, leads to unable folding production to the cardboard.

Detailed Description
The present invention will be further described with reference to the accompanying drawings.
Referring to fig. 1-4, the present embodiment comprises a base 1, a bracket 2, a worktable 3, and a clamping plate 9, wherein the bracket 2 is welded on the base 1, the worktable 3 is welded on the bracket 2, a groove 4 is formed on the worktable 3, two ends of the groove 4 are respectively arranged to run through the left and right sides of the worktable 3, a guide rod 5 is welded on the base 1, the guide rod 5 is arranged below the worktable 3, a guide sleeve 6 is movably sleeved on the guide rod 5, a connecting plate 7 is welded on the guide sleeve 6, a socket 8 is formed on the worktable 3, the socket 8 is arranged at two ends of the groove 4, the socket 8 is arranged to run through the groove 4, the connecting plate 7 is movably arranged in the socket 8, the clamping plate 9 is welded on the upper end of the connecting plate 7, the clamping plate 9 is arranged above the groove 4, a slot 10 is formed on the clamping plate 9, the slot 10 is arranged above the groove 4, a pressure plate 11 is welded on the guide sleeve 6, a screw rod 12 is welded on the base 1, the screw rod 12 is movably arranged on the pressure plate 11 in a penetrating way, a screw nut 13 is screwed on the screw rod 12, and the screw nut 13 is movably arranged on the upper surface of the pressure plate 11 in an abutting way; the base 1 is welded with a sliding rail 14, the sliding rail 14 is arranged on the rear side of the support 2, a sliding block 15 is arranged on the sliding rail 14 in a sliding mode, a cutting machine 16 is riveted on the sliding block 15, a cutter head of the cutting machine 16 is arranged above the groove 10, and the cutting machine is a disc type cutting machine capable of cutting a paperboard in the prior art.
Further, the left end and the right end of the slot 10 are communicated with the left side edge and the right side edge of the clamping plate 9, the upper end of the connecting plate 7 is provided with a notch 17, the notch 17 is communicated with the slot 10, the opening of the slot 10 is arranged, and the notch 17 on the connecting plate 7 can facilitate clamping of the paperboard, the connecting plate 7 is inserted into the groove 4, the notch 17 is communicated with the groove 4, and a cutter head of the cutting machine 16 can conveniently pass through the notch.
Further, the guide rod 5 is sleeved with a spring 18, the upper end of the spring 18 movably abuts against the lower end of the guide sleeve 6, the lower end of the spring 18 movably abuts against the base 1, and after a working cycle is completed and the nut 13 is loosened, the spring pushes the guide sleeve 6 to reset.
Furthermore, a sliding rod 19 is welded on the workbench 3, the sliding rod 19 is arranged on the front side of the pressing plate 11, a sliding sleeve 20 is slidably sleeved on the sliding rod 19, a wedge block 21 is welded on the sliding sleeve 20, the wedge block 21 is slidably inserted into the groove 4, and paper scraps in the groove 4 can be removed through the wedge block 21 by sliding the sliding sleeve 20.
Furthermore, the slide bar 19 on be equipped with the extension spring 22, the right-hand member of extension spring 22 welds the right-hand member of establishing at slide bar 19, and the left end of extension spring 22 welds on sliding sleeve 20, and extension spring 22 pulling sliding sleeve 20 resets.
The working principle of the specific embodiment is as follows: the cardboard that will need to tailor presss from both sides between splint 9 and workstation 3, screw 13 rotates, push up clamp plate 11 downwards, make clamp plate 11 hold uide bushing 6 and move down, finally through fixing connecting plate 7 on uide bushing 6, will pull down with splint 9 that connecting plate 7 is fixed, make splint 9 press from both sides the cardboard tightly on workstation 3, in this process, the position of cardboard needs to be adjusted, make the incision mark of cardboard expose in the fluting 10 on splint 9, treat that the cardboard presss from both sides tight back, slide block 15, tailor the cardboard through cutting machine 16 on the slider 15, after tailoring, rotatory screw 13 loosens clamp plate 11, and then loosens splint 9, take out the cardboard, take out the waste material strip of accomplishing of tailorring.
